Local State Corporatism in the Tourism Development of the Ancient Town of Fenghuang: Logic and Consequences
PENG Dan, ZHANG Ziyan
Tourism and Hospitality Prospects    2022, 6 (2): 43-65.   DOI: 10.12054/lydk.bisu.190
Abstract446)   HTML5067)    PDF (13308KB)(130)       Save

Local state corporatism is a development strategy generated in a specific social environment. It aims to study the relationship between government and enterprises in local economic development and social structure evolution. Taking the ancient town of Fenghuang as an example, this paper analyzes the process of the operation, development, and management of destination tourism in ancient towns based on the theory of local state corporatism. Evidence has shown that the operation of local state corporatism in the development of tourist destinations involves three stakeholders: authority, capital, and society. These stakeholders participate in the tourism development of ancient towns with their respective roles and behavioral characteristics and, in so doing, present a game relationship of diversified interests. The authority force conspires with the capital force to promote the development of local tourism, but social forces have also played a role in influencing the formation mechanism and development direction of local state corporatism. However, this type of operating logic can cause defects in the model itself, which can easily lead to certain social consequences. Thus, the government must exert its powerful administrative force to intervene in and overcome these potential problems.

Research Progress on Social Memory in Tourism Destinations from 1998 to 2019 : Based on the Keyword Co-Emerging Network
PENG Dan,HU Junqing
Tourism and Hospitality Prospects    2020, 4 (4): 74-93.   DOI: 10.12054/lydk.bisu.146
Abstract811)   HTML35)    PDF (4093KB)(1968)       Save

This article quantitatively analyzes the literature of social memory in tourist destinations from 1998 to 2019, with the help of the keyword co-emerging network and Ucinet. The results show that: (1) the common focus of research on social memory in domestic and foreign tourist destinations is collective memory, heritage tourism, rural tourism and the issue of the development of local culture.(2)There are differences in the dimensions and research methods of social memory classification in domestic and foreign tourist destinations.(3)In China, small-scale areas such as historical and cultural heritage sites and revolutionary memorial sites are used as research areas, while foreign countries mainly study large-scale areas such as national social memory.(4)The theme of research on social memory in tourist destinations is increasingly integrated. The research perspective is becoming more micro, modular and hierarchical. Through the analysis of the different stages of the hot spots of social memory research in domestic and foreign tourist destinations, this research is expected to provide a reference for further in-depth study of social memory in tourist destinations.

A Study of Slow Tourism and Its Causes in the Old Town of Lijiang
PENG Dan,QU Hailun
Tourism and Hospitality Prospects    2020, 4 (2): 64-76.   DOI: 10.12054/lydk.bisu.126
Abstract1310)   HTML25)    PDF (1945KB)(1962)       Save

In recent years, slow tourism has attracted the attention of scholars at home and abroad, but there are few empirical analyses of cases from the “tourism and modernity” perspective. Using the interview data of interviewees and potential tourists who have visited the Old Town of Lijiang, qualitative research methods were applied to the high-frequency word extraction and rooted theory coding analysis of the interviews to explore the two dimensions of slow tourism—environment and slow travel experience—in the Old Town of Lijiang. At the same time, the development of the Old Town of Lijiang as a slow tourist destination is primarily due to the interaction between the natural environment and the local life, which is the basis of local slow tourism. Tourism stakeholders have also created the symbols of “slowness.” The meaning is in line with the needs of contemporary tourists and promotes the development of slow tourism in the Old Town of Lijiang.
